Scarlett Liu is a scholar working on Plant Science, Ecology and Environmental Engineering. According to data from OpenAlex, Scarlett Liu has authored 24 papers receiving a total of 772 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Plant Science, 7 papers in Ecology and 7 papers in Environmental Engineering. Recurrent topics in Scarlett Liu's work include Horticultural and Viticultural Research (11 papers), Smart Agriculture and AI (7 papers) and Remote Sensing in Agriculture (7 papers). Scarlett Liu is often cited by papers focused on Horticultural and Viticultural Research (11 papers), Smart Agriculture and AI (7 papers) and Remote Sensing in Agriculture (7 papers). Scarlett Liu collaborates with scholars based in Australia and China. Scarlett Liu's co-authors include Mark Whitty, Jiqiang Niu, Tanghong Liu, Dan Zhou, Xifeng Liang, Paul R. Petrie, Zitong Zhou, Jingsong Xie, M.A. Skewes and Xuesong Li and has published in prestigious journals such as IEEE Access, IEEE Transactions on Intelligent Transportation Systems and Computers and Electronics in Agriculture.
